Note that when this had occurred, creating a queue when connected to one node that reported only three members was nevertheless propagated to all four nodes.
This was fixed as a side effect of r948143, ported to mrg_1.3.x branch: http://mrg1.lab.bos.redhat.com/git/?p=qpid.git;a=commitdiff;h=87a548b4b5e525bd887fd486469e63ed9bd79c03
